Why Background Removal Matters for E-commerce Success

Clean, consistent backgrounds drive measurable improvements in conversion rates. Amazon’s own data shows that products with white backgrounds convert 30% better than those with cluttered or inconsistent backgrounds. Beyond conversion metrics, professional-looking images build trust with potential customers and help products stand out in crowded marketplace search results.

Traditional photo editing requires significant skill and time investment. Professional retouching services typically charge $5-15 per image, while DIY editing can take 15-30 minutes per photo for acceptable results. AI tools have compressed this timeline to under 30 seconds per image while maintaining professional quality standards.

Top AI Background Removal Tools Compared

Remove.bg

Perhaps the most recognizable name in AI background removal, Remove.bg processes over 100 million images monthly. The tool excels with human subjects but performs admirably on products, particularly those with clear edge definition. Pricing starts at $0.20 per image for pay-as-you-go users, dropping to $0.09 per image on higher-volume plans.

Strengths include exceptional hair and fur detection, making it ideal for pet products or apparel worn by models. The API integration allows for bulk processing, though the 25-megapixel limit may constrain users working with high-resolution product photography.

Canva Background Remover

Integrated into Canva’s broader design ecosystem, this tool offers convenience for sellers already using the platform for marketing materials. Pro subscribers get unlimited background removal as part of their $12.99 monthly subscription, making it cost-effective for high-volume users.

The tool performs well on simple products but struggles with complex textures or transparent materials. Its strength lies in seamless integration with Canva’s design tools, allowing users to immediately place products on new backgrounds or create marketing graphics.

Adobe Photoshop’s AI-Powered Selection

Photoshop’s Object Selection tool leverages Adobe Sensei AI to identify and isolate subjects automatically. While not a dedicated background removal service, it offers unprecedented control over the editing process. The $20.99 monthly Creative Cloud subscription provides access to the full Adobe ecosystem.

This option suits users requiring pixel-perfect results or complex compositing work. The learning curve is steep, but the results can surpass dedicated background removal tools, particularly for challenging subjects like glass products or items with reflective surfaces.

Choosing the Right Tool for Your Business

Volume considerations should drive tool selection. Sellers processing fewer than 50 images monthly may find pay-per-use options most economical. Medium-volume sellers (50-500 images monthly) often benefit from subscription-based tools with generous usage limits. High-volume operations typically require API access or enterprise solutions to maintain efficiency.

Product type significantly impacts tool performance. Simple products with clear edges—electronics, books, basic apparel—work well with any competent AI tool. Complex products present challenges: jewelry requires tools that preserve fine details and handle reflective surfaces, while clothing benefits from solutions that understand fabric textures and maintain natural draping.

Quality Assessment Framework

Evaluate potential tools using a consistent sample set representing your product range. Key quality indicators include edge accuracy, particularly around fine details; handling of semi-transparent areas like glass or plastic; and consistency across similar products. Most tools offer free trials or sample processing to facilitate comparison.

Processing speed becomes crucial for high-volume operations. Tools claiming “instant” results may take 10-30 seconds per image, while others require several minutes for complex subjects. Batch processing capabilities can dramatically improve workflow efficiency for catalog updates or seasonal product additions.

Integration and Workflow Optimization

Modern e-commerce operations benefit from automated workflows connecting photography, editing, and listing creation. Many AI background removal tools offer API access, enabling integration with inventory management systems or automated listing tools. This automation can reduce the time from product photography to live listing by 60-80%.

Consider tools that output marketplace-ready formats automatically. Amazon requires square images with products occupying 85% of the frame, while other marketplaces have different specifications. Tools that understand these requirements eliminate additional formatting steps.
